Manchester United’s search for a permanent manager continues with drama over one of the potential candidates

Some members of the Manchester United hierarchy reportedly have concerns over the possibility of appointing Crystal Palace manager Oliver Glasner, with him being likened to Ruben Amorim.

Glasner is set to leave Palace at the end of the current campaign, having led the Eagles to FA Cup glory last season. There are also doubts over his immediate future amid increasing tensions between him and the club.

The Austrian is said to feature highly on United’s shortlist as they search for a new permanent manager in the summer. But the i paper report that there are some doubts over Glasner from United.

The report adds that there are fears that Glasner is at the ‘same level’ as Amorim was when United appointed the former Sporting manager. They are not prepared to make the same mistake again, believing that Amorim wasn’t ready to take on a job as big as the United one.

Glasner is under increasing pressure at Palace. Some sections of the travelling fans called for his sacking during Thursday night’s 1-1 draw with Zrinjski Mostar.

Speaking about his future on Friday, he made an honest admission: “Let’s see what the future brings,” he said.

“You never know. I’m always realistic, and we’re not in the best moment right now, and to be honest, I understand, and I take responsibility for everything because I’m responsible for the whole team.

“And right now, I’m just not good enough to replace the players we sold.

“I’m just not good enough to integrate the new players in a way to play the same way like we did, and I’m not good enough that we can cope with the schedule we had.”

While United will be looking ahead to the summer, it’s reported that the clubs will not make any approaches to potential candidates yet, as things are going well on the pitch. It’s been added that the job Michael Carrick has been doing so far on an interim basis makes him a strong candidate for the permanent position.

The former midfielder is unbeaten in his first five games in charge of the club since joining until the end of the season. United have climbed into the Champions League positions, having won four and drawn one of the five games so far.
